Nurture
The word nurture means to feed and protect: to nurture one's offspring. To support and encourage, as during the period of training or development; foster: to nurture promising musicians. When used as a noun it means to rear, upbringing, education, or the like. development: the nurture of young artists, something that nourishes; nourishment; food.
The word nurture may be associated with a woman who nurtures her child as it grows up. The word nurture may have a spiritual aspect for some people. For example, to provide (someone) with moral or spiritual understanding<she feels that her lifelong practice of reading the Bible daily has nurtured her in ways she cannot describe>.
